Understanding the Calculator’s Output:

File Size Reduction Tool outputs two essential metrics: the compression ratio and the space saved. The compression ratio illustrates the extent of file size reduction achieved through compression, providing insight into the effectiveness of the process. A higher compression ratio signifies more efficient compression. On the other hand, the space saved metric quantifies the amount of storage space conserved as a result of compression.

This tangible measurement demonstrates the practical benefits of data compression in terms of resource optimization and efficient storage utilization.
